      Approximately 40 airmen from the 621st Contingency Response Wing at Joint Base McGuire-Dix- Lakehurst in central New Jersey have arrived in Pakistan to support flood relief operations in the wake of massive flooding that has killed more than 1,600 people and affected another 17 million Pakistanis.       • Books are being collected by the Friends of the Plumsted Library for a book sale to be held in November. Fiction, nonfiction, large print, children’s books, CDs, DVDs, audio books and jigsaw puzzles will be accepted. No videotapes, Readers Digest condensed books, magazines or encyclopedias are needed.
